Flavonoids are a class of secondary plant phenolics with significant antioxidant and chelating properties. They act in plants as antioxidants, antimicrobials, photoreceptors, visual attractors, feeding repellants, and for light screening. Antioxidant action of flavonoids may also result from activation of antioxidant enzymes, such as catalase, glutathione.
